I'm sorry, let me elaborate. I was looking for an arcane-only full or near-full spellcating class which has a relation to Mystra of some type. Or if not that, the closest I can get to it. I did do a google search though.
Ah, gotcha. I think most of her PrCs have had some Divine prereqs, but there were at least a few which were also Arcane ... Hathran, maybe? Blue Moon Knight? Definite Divine requirements there though.

What aspects of her portfolio were you looking to specialize in as an arcanist?

Well, the concept I have in mind is basically a devote follower of Mystra who believes that using divine magic instead of arcane is a personal affront to Mystra and therefore, unless unavoidable, goes out of his way to stay away from it. (still takes healing from a cleric if its all thats there, etc but he prefers not to) Basically the type who praises Mystra for ever successful spell cast.
 

Nifft

Penguin Herder
That's cool, but it sounds like a behavior rather than an ability -- in other words, something you could easily do with a regular Wizard (or Sorcerer ... or both with Ultimate Magus).

Why do you feel you need a prestige class? As in, what's the Wizard missing?

Dweomerkeeper from Faiths and Pantheons, although it does have some divine requirements as well. But would that really count as it also came direct from Mystra.

The Ultimate Magus fromm Complete Mage combines Wizard and Sorcerer and has some neat synergies.

Because Mystra's the goddes of all MAGIC, not just Arcane Magic, you'll have a hard time finding pure Mystra Arcane classes (though an Arcane Disciple of Mystra should certainly do it for you if you don't mind having divine Mystra-granted abilities).
